change volume name

I need some help;

I want to change the volume name but don´t know how to?

If you want to change the name of a volume, such as that for a hard drive or a partitio to one, you do it exactly the same way as changing thee name of a file. Click the volume's icon once to select it, then press the Return key; this will put the volume's filename into edit mode. Type in the ne name, then press return again.


Note 1 - if you're referring to a CD or similar volume, one which is locked or otherwise can not be written to, you can not change its name.


Note 2 - if you're using File Sharing on a network, changing the name of a volume will interfere with access between machines.
